Abstract
L'invention concerne un tube à rayons X. Ce tube comporte une enveloppe vidée d'air qui contient une unité d'anode et une unité de cathode constituée par une anticathode fixée sur un rotor. L'enveloppe comporte des parties d'extrémité en verre et une partie intermédiaire en métal. Une pièce d'isolement thermique, sous forme d'un disque en cuivre, est disposée entre l'anticathode et le rotor pour que ce dernier ne soit pas échauffé par la chaleur émise par l'anticathode. L'invention s'applique notamment à des tubes à rayons X de grande puissance.
